客户在使用虚拟主机时遇到FTP连接失败的问题,同时部分图片上传也出现了异常。客户怀疑是FTP配置或服务器权限设置不当导致的。

解答:

操作步骤 描述
验证FTP登录凭证 首先,请确保提供的FTP用户名和密码是正确的。有时复制粘贴过程中可能会不小心带入多余的空格字符,导致登录失败。建议手动输入一次,以排除此类低级错误。如果仍然无法登录,请尝试重置密码后再试。
检查FTP配置文件 FTP连接失败可能是由于配置文件中的参数设置不正确引起的。请检查FTP服务器的配置文件(如vsftpd.conf),确保监听的端口号、允许的IP范围等设置均符合实际需求。如有必要,可以根据官方文档进行适当调整。
确认服务器防火墙规则 某些安全策略可能会限制FTP服务的正常运行。请检查服务器防火墙规则,确保放行了必要的端口(如21、20)。如果使用了第三方安全插件(如云锁),请确认它们不会干扰FTP服务的正常使用。
排查图片上传问题 图片上传异常可能是由多种原因引起的。首先,检查Web服务器(如Apache、Nginx)的配置文件,确保最大允许上传的文件大小设置合理。其次,确认图片格式是否被允许上传,某些CMS系统会维护一个白名单,只有列入其中的格式才能成功上传。最后,查看是否有足够的磁盘空间可供使用,磁盘满可能导致上传失败。
调试日志分析 如果以上措施仍未能解决问题,建议启用详细的调试日志功能,记录下每次FTP连接和图片上传的具体过程。通过分析日志文件,您可以更准确地定位问题所在,并采取相应的补救措施。

总之,FTP连接失败和图片上传异常通常是由于配置不当或权限设置错误引起的。通过逐步排查各个可能的因素,并结合实际情况进行调整,您可以有效解决这些问题,确保用户能够顺利使用FTP服务并上传所需的图片资源。如果您在操作过程中遇到任何困难,欢迎随时联系我们获取进一步的帮助。